Artemis Investment Management LLP grew its position in Fluor Co. (NYSE:FLR - Free Report) by 49.1%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The fund owned 1,252,876 shares of the construction company's stock after buying an additional 412,312 shares during the period. Artemis Investment Management LLP owned approximately 0.73% of Fluor worth $61,792,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Fluor Corporation provides eng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C); fabrication and modularization; operation and maintenance; asset integrity; and project management services worldwide. The company operates through Energy Solutions, Urban Solutions, Mission Solutions, and Other segments. The Energy Solutions segment provides solutions to the energy transition markets, including asset decarbonization, carbon capture, renewable fuels, waste-to-energy, green chemicals, hydrogen, nuclear power, and other low-carbon energy sources.
